Recognizing Low-VOC Paints



When you choose low-VOC paints, you're choosing an item that produces less volatile organic compounds, which can be damaging to both your wellness and the setting.


VOCs are chemicals found in many paint products that can vaporize into the air and contribute to indoor air contamination. By selecting low-VOC alternatives, you're reducing the variety of these emissions, making your space much safer.

Low-VOC paints normally contain 50 grams per litre or fewer VOCs, contrasted to traditional paints that can have up to 250 grams per liter. This implies that when you paint your home with low-VOC items, you're not simply making a choice for aesthetic appeals; you're additionally taking an action towards a much healthier indoor atmosphere.
